Pulses are nutritious edible seeds of leguminous plants, widely consumed as a staple food across many cultures due to their high protein content and excellent nutritional value. Common varieties include lentils, chickpeas, mung beans, pigeon peas, black gram, and kidney beans, all known for being rich in plant-based protein, dietary fiber, complex carbohydrates, vitamins, and essential minerals such as iron and potassium. Pulses support digestive health, help maintain steady energy levels, and contribute to heart health and balanced nutrition.
